I have a 20 gallon planted tank that has been running for a couple months now and I recently been having issues with my Dwarf Rasboras. They had been in a 15 gallon for a year or so prior with no issues. I've lost two recently both to the same illness. They start to turn black and waste away despite healthy eating. I have been dosing my tank with Sulfathiazole per advice from my LFS but another rasbora has started to show signs of illness.

I plan to isolate the rasboras in my hospital tank but not sure how to treat. I haven't seen any symptoms in tank mates. Water parameters are good, 0 nitrite, 0 ammonia. I have a fluval 305 filter and I am running mechanical filtration media. Any help would be appreciated.
